CPU QB Accuracy

CPU QB's are way too accurate at default. As an offline player this wouldn't be a problem since we can adjust sliders. However, the CPU QB accuracy slider is much less responsive than on the user side. Lowering QB accuracy for CPU typically just results in more wobbly passes that are still within the receivers catch radius. When lowering the accuracy of the user you can see many off target misfires which are very common for college QBs. For a more realistic experience I am just asking if you can make an adjustment so that the CPU QB accuracy slider works the same way as the user. This could greatly improve sim gameplay. Ratings need to matter for CPU QBs, and even elite QBs should have misfires without being pressured.
